Sr. Sde, Mla Hardware/software Co-design, Annapurna Labs Machine Learning Acceleration

Amazon Amazon · Big Tech · Austin, TX · Software Development

This role focuses on the pre-silicon hardware/software co-development for machine learning chips, involving work with architecture, design, and emulation teams to build and test next-generation AI chips. The responsibilities include writing bare-metal software and ML workloads to verify chip functionality and performance.

What you'd actually do

  1. driving the pre-silicon hardware/software co-development for our machine learning chips
  2. work with architecture, design and emulation teams to build and test our next generation AI chips
  3. write bare-metal software and ML workloads to verify the end-to-end functionality and performance of the SoC

Skills

Required

  • ASIC implementation
  • synthesis
  • STA
  • physical design
  • digital design
  • embedded software
  • system development
  • chip design
  • bare-metal software development
  • ML workloads
  • UVM
  • C
  • System C
  • Python
  • Embedded C programming
  • communication theory
  • OFDM
  • MIMO
  • Digital/Wireless Communication Systems
  • RF engineering
  • Agile
  • TDD
  • BDD
  • CI
  • Git
  • PHY/MAC layer HW/SW development
  • SoCs
  • FPGAs
  • general-purpose processors
  • version control systems
  • CI/CD pipeline implementation

Nice to have

  • RTL coding
  • debug
  • performance analysis
  • power analysis
  • area analysis
  • ASIC/FPGA design tools
  • verification tools